Paquebot Mail: 1969 (July 1) Baltic Steamship Company 'Baltika' multicolored picture postcard to England franked with two USSR 4k Lenin House singles tied by Danish 'Paquebot Kobenhavn' duplex (Dovey/Morris #552), One stamp overlapping the card's top edge, and minor tone spot at bottom

Russia & Soviet Union / Covers & Postcards

Launched in 1940 as the Vyacheslav Molotov, and renamed Baltika in 1955, the ship supposedly transported Soviet Union Premier Khrushchev to the United Nations in New York in 1960, and continued in service until 1987
